The three-day festival takes place Friday, September 11th through Sunday, September 13th at Kutcher's Country Club in Monticello, NY.
In addition to live performances from Hopewell, The Flaming Lips, The Jesus Lizard, Animal Collective, The Melvins and No Age with Bob Mould, ATP NY boasts a film portion as well as a comedy stage curated by David Cross.
Hopewell's most recent album entitled Good Good Desperation is available now on Tee Pee Records. - http://www.myspace.com/hopewell
